Output 2c0275403df3ed4697e7dcfd8d763aa75d3835aff1ac087f8b19fc811804451e:0

value
22984132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ec322ebbdf4b7a0fea595d91eb7fa6af82add469 OP_EQUAL
address
3PDuWZUXxEHrdMCajBF8ns49b3DtdGvna8
transaction
2c0275403df3ed4697e7dcfd8d763aa75d3835aff1ac087f8b19fc811804451e
spent
true